مطالب پیشنهادی از سراسر وب

پایتون برای خودکارسازی امنیت اطلاعات

دسته بندی ها: آموزش پایتون (Python) ، آموزش های Packtpub

روند یافتن و ریشه کن کردن یک مهاجم وقت گیر بوده و هزینه های زیادی را در پی دارد که به سازمان شما آسیب می رساند. شما باید ابزاری بنویسید که به شما کمک کند امنیت دفاعی و تهاجمی خود را به صورت خودکار انجام دهید. به عنوان یک تستر نفوذ، شما باید به سرعت پیشرفت کنید. هنگامی که ابزارهای آماده و اکسپلویت ها کم می آورند، نوشتن ابزار خودتان به شما کمک می کند تا از داده های خود محافظت کنید. در این دوره، یاد بگیرید که چگونه از پایتون برای انجام کارهای معمول و سریع و کارآمد استفاده کنید. شما تحلیل لاگ و تحلیل بسته را با عملیات فایل، عبارت های منظم و ماژول های تحلیل، خودکار خواهید کرد؛ برای جمع آوری اطلاعات با وب سایت ها تعامل برقرار می کنید و برنامه های سرور و TCP client را برای استفاده در تست نفوذ توسعه می دهید. شما خواهید آموخت که چگونه ابزارهای خودکار را برای امنیت اطلاعات بسازید و امیدوارم دریابید که این نمونه ها به شما کمک می کند تا ابزار خودتان را طراحی کرده و بسازید!
در پایان این دوره، شما مهارت ها و اعتماد به نفس لازم را برای خودکار سازی تکنیک های امنیتی تهاجمی و دفاعی با استفاده از پایتون را خواهید داشت و چندین ابزار کوچک امنیتی و یک ابزار بزرگ تست نفوذ گسترده ایجاد کرده اید که همگی می توانند در دنیای واقعی استفاده شوند.
تمامی کدها و فایل های پشتیبانی این دوره در GitHub موجود هستند.

آیا این نوشته را دوست داشتید؟
Packt Python for Automating Information Security Duration:2 hours 38 minutes

The process of finding and eradicating an attacker is time-consuming and costs a lot, which hurts your organization. You need to write tools that will help you automate your defensive and offensive security. As a penetration tester, you need to evolve quickly. When off-the-shelf tools and exploits fall short, writing your own tool will help you safeguard your data. In this course, learn how to leverage Python to perform routine tasks quickly and efficiently. You will automate log analysis and packet analysis with file operations, regular expressions, and analysis modules; interact with websites to collect intelligence; and develop TCP client and server applications for use in penetration testing. You will learn how to build automation tools for information security, and will hopefully find that these examples will help inspire you to design and build your own!
By the end of this course, you will have the skills and confidence you need to automate both offensive and defensive security techniques using Python; and have developed several small security tools and one large comprehensive penetration testing tool, all of which can be used in the real world.
All the code and supporting files for this course are available on GitHub at: https://github.com/PacktPublishing/Python-for-Automating-Information-Security

پیشنهاد آموزش مرتبط در فرادرس